101 programming resources
1.0.0

Erhalten Sie 101 vollständig kostenlose Programmierressourcen, die möglicherweise Ihre Codierungsfähigkeiten verbessern können.
Führen Sie gemeinnützige Organisationen durch, die Lernenden auf der ganzen Welt Codierungsunterricht bieten?
Haben Sie einen YouTube -Kanal, der anderen hilft, Programmierung zu lernen? ?
Schreiben Sie Blogs, um Programmierer auf der ganzen Welt zu unterstützen? ❤️
| Ausweis | Ressourcen | Beschreibung |
|---|---|---|
| 1 | Freecodecamp | FreecodeCamp ist eine gemeinnützige Organisation, die aus einer interaktiven Lern-Webplattform besteht. Ihre Mission ist es, den Menschen kostenlos zu helfen. Laut Freecodecamp haben mehr als 40.000 Absolventen Arbeitsplätze gelandet, nachdem sie mindestens eine Zertifizierung über Freecodecamp abgeschlossen haben. Absolventen haben Arbeit bei Apple, Google, Spotify und anderen Technologieunternehmen gefunden |
| 2 | Das ODIN -Projekt | Das ODIN -Projekt ermöglicht es aufstrebende Webentwickler, kostenlos gemeinsam zu lernen. Ihr volles Stack -Lehrplan ist kostenlos und unterstützt von einer leidenschaftlichen Open -Source -Community. |
| 3 | Coursera | Coursera bietet Hunderte von Kursen von Top -Unternehmen und Universitäten und Sie können die Kurse prüfen oder finanzielle Unterstützung beantragen, wenn Sie nicht über die finanzielle Stabilität verfügen. |
| 4 | Udemy | Selbst harte Udemy ist nicht kostenlos, sie haben viele Kurse, die für alle vollständig verfügbar sind. Sie können sie hier finden |
| 5 | EDX | EDX ist ein weiterer massiver Open Online -Kursanbieter, der von Harvard und MIT erstellt wurde. |
| 6 | Codecademy | Codecademy ist eine amerikanische interaktive Plattform für Online |
| 7 | Udacity | Udacity bietet kostenlose Informatikkurse, die von Branchenexperten unterrichtet werden. Udacity bietet zwei Arten von Kursen - reguläre Kurse und Nanodegrees. Regelmäßige Kurse sind kostenlos. Regelmäßige Kurse mit Einzelunterrichts-/Codeüberprüfung erfordern eine monatliche Gebühr. Nanodegrees sind in der Regel für Menschen mit früheren Codierungserfahrungen und kosten mehr Geld. |
| 8 | Khan Academy | Sie bieten mehrstündige, selbstgeprägte Kurse in JavaScript, HTML/CSS und SQL an |
| 9 | YouTube | YouTube ist möglicherweise eine der süchtig machenden Anwendungen, die Sie möglicherweise in Ihrem Leben verwendet haben. Beachten Sie jedoch, dass dies auch der beste Weg ist, um im Jahr 2022 in die Programmierung zu kommen, wenn sie vorsichtig verwendet werden. |
| 10 | MIT openCourseware | MIT openCourseware ist eine webbasierte Veröffentlichung praktisch aller MIT -Kursinhalte. |
| 11 | Code.org | Ihr Motto lautet "Informatik lernen. |
| 12 | Kratzen | Scratch ist eine hochrangige blockbasierte visuelle Programmiersprache und eine Website, die hauptsächlich auf Kinder als Bildungsinstrument für die Programmierung abzielt, mit einer Zielgruppe im Alter von 8 bis 16 Jahren. |
| 13 | Stackoverflow | Dieser braucht nicht viel Einführung. Stackoverflow ist eine Plattform, auf der Sie programmierende Fragen stellen können. |
| 14 | Leetcode | Leetcode ist die beste Plattform, um Ihre Fähigkeiten zu verbessern, Ihr Wissen zu erweitern und sich auf technische Interviews vorzubereiten. |
| 15 | Hackerrank | Hackerrank ist die marktführende technische Bewertung und eine Ferninterviewlösung für die Einstellung von Entwicklern. |
| 16 | Codechef | Code-Chef ist ein Online-Bildungsprogramm und eine wettbewerbsfähige Programmiergemeinschaft globaler Programmierer. |
| 17 | Hackerearth | Hilft mehr als 3 Millionen Entwicklern, durch Codierungswettbewerbe, Datenwissenschaftswettbewerbe und Hackathons besser zu programmieren. |
| 18 | CS50: Einführung in die Informatik | Ein Einstiegskurs von David J. Malan, CS50X, unterrichtet den Schülern, wie sie algorithmisch denken und Probleme effizient lösen können. Zu den Themen gehören Abstraktion, Algorithmen, Datenstrukturen, Kapselung, Ressourcenmanagement, Sicherheit, Software -Engineering und Webentwicklung. Zu den Sprachen gehören C, Python, SQL und JavaScript Plus CSS und HTML. Problemsätze, die von realen Domänen von Biologie, Kryptographie, Finanzen, Forensik und Spielen inspiriert sind. Die Auf dem Campus-Version von CS50X, CS50, ist Harvards größter Kurs. |
| 19 | Codingame | Site, auf der Sie an Problemlösungsfähigkeiten arbeiten und die Grundlagen für Programmierungen durch ein rundenbasiertes Spiel erlernen können. |
| 20 | CSS Diner | In CSS Diner können Sie die Grundlagen von CSS durch eine Reihe von 32 Herausforderungen üben. Dies ist eine gute Möglichkeit, sich mit der Sprache vertraut zu machen und sich Spaß daran zu haben, sie zu lernen. |
| 21 | Codecombat | Codecombat funktioniert gut für Kinder und Erwachsene. Sie können ein kostenloses Konto erstellen und die Grundlagen der Programmierung wie Schleifen, Funktionen, Bedingungen und Variablen lernen. |
| 22 | Tynker | Tynker ist eine Website, auf der Sie Projekte erstellen und Spiele mit HTML, CSS, JavaScript, Python und Java spielen können. Sie haben eine umfangreiche Liste von Projekten, Algorithmen und Datenstrukturherausforderungen. |
| 23 | SQL Mord Mystery | SQL Murder Mystery ist großartig für Anfänger und erfahrene SQL -Entwickler. Stärken Sie Ihre SQL- und Problemlösungsfähigkeiten, indem Sie versuchen, den Mörder in diesem Krimi aufzuspüren. Das Spiel verwendet SQLite und Sie müssen sich zunächst mit der Datenbankstruktur vertraut machen, bevor Sie das Spiel starten. |
| 24 | Nicht vertrauen | Unversteuert ist ein Abenteuerspiel, bei dem Sie Ihre Fähigkeiten mit JavaScript und Problemlösungen testen können. |
| 25 | Checkio | Checkio ist ein Strategiespiel, bei dem Sie Typenkript oder Python durch eine Reihe von Herausforderungen lernen können. |
| 26 | W3schools | W3Schools ist eine Freemium -Bildungswebsite zum Online -Kodieren mit Echtzeitbeispielen. |
| 27 | Geeksforgeeks | Ein Informatikportal für Geeks. Es enthält gut geschriebene, gut nachgedachte und gut erklärte Informatik- und Programmierartikel und ist eine Plattform, um Programmierprobleme zu üben. |
| 28 | Tutsplus | Entdecken Sie kostenlose Tutorials und Videokurse mit TutSplus. Erstellen Sie eine App, erstellen Sie eine Website oder lernen Sie eine neue Fähigkeit. |
| 29 | Sololearn | Erhalten Sie Zugang zu Kursen, die von Experten mit realer Praxis entworfen wurden. |
| 30 | Entwickler.mozilla.org | MDN Web Docs, zuvor Mozilla Developer Network und früher Mozilla Developer Center, ist ein Dokumentations -Repository und eine Lernressource für Webentwickler. Es wurde 2005 von Mozilla als einheitlicher Ort für Dokumentation zu offenen Webstandards, Mozillas eigenen Projekten und Entwicklerführern gestartet. |
| 31 | JavaScript | Wie der Name schon sagt, ist es eine kostenlose Anleitung für Programmierer, die JavaScript lernen möchten |
| 32 | Studytonight.com | Bester Ort zum Erlernen von technischen Fächern wie Core Java, C ++, DBMs, Datenstrukturen usw. durch handgeschriebenes einfaches Tutorial, Tests und Video-Tutorials. |
| 33 | Programmiz | Lernen Sie, in Python, C/C ++, Java und anderen beliebten Programmiersprachen zu codieren, wobei sie leicht zu folgen, Beispielen, Beispielen, Online -Compiler und Referenzen folgen. |
| 34 | Ruby Warrior | Wenn Sie Ruby lernen möchten, ist Ruby Warrior das Spiel für Sie. Es gibt Anfänger- und Zwischenspuren, die Ihrem Fähigkeitsniveau entsprechen. Die Lektionen beginnen leicht und gehen von dort aus. |
| 35 | Github | Ja, du hast das richtig gehört! GitHub ist der beste Ort, um Ihre Codierungsreise zu beginnen. Sie können Hunderte von Quellcode lesen, die von anderen Programmierern in GitHub geschrieben wurden. Sie können auch viele Herausforderungen und Ressourcen finden, um Ihre Codierungsfähigkeiten zu stärken. |
| 36 | Codepen | CodePen ist eine Online-Community zum Testen und Präsentieren von benutzergeeinigten HTML-, CSS- und JavaScript-Code-Snippets. Es fungiert als Online-Code-Editor und Open-Source-Lernumgebung, in der Entwickler Code-Snippets erstellen können, die als "Stifte" bezeichnet werden, und sie testen können. |
| 37 | Swift -Spielplätze | Swift ist eine Programmiersprache, die von Apple erstellt und von Fachleuten verwendet wird, um Apps für die Verwendung auf Apple -Geräten zu erstellen. Mit der Swift Playgrounds -App können die Schüler Swift durch eine ansprechende und unterhaltsame Reihe von Herausforderungen lernen. |
| 38 | Wenn Sie es noch nicht getan haben, haben Sie wahrscheinlich gehört, dass sich ein Entwickler scherzhaft als professionelles Googler bezeichnet. Während des übertriebenen Spruchs hält das Sprichwort ein Lappen der Wahrheit. Google ist eine wertvolle Ressource für Programmierer, und viele Codierungsprobleme können mit einer einfachen Suche gelöst werden. | |
| 39 | Simpleilearn | Simplilearn ist die beliebte Online -Lernplattform für Bootcamp- und Online -Kurse. |
| 40 | Sqlzoo | SQLZOO ist die Online-Ressource zum Erlernen von allem SQL. Aus SQLZOO können Sie SQL Server, Oracle, MySQL, DB2 und PostgressQL kennenlernen. Erfahren Sie aus verschiedenen interaktiven Tutorials und Referenzstücken und testen Sie Ihre neuen Fähigkeiten mit Bewertungen. |
| 41 | Codeschule | Wenn Sie sich nicht sicher sind, wo Sie anfangen sollen, bietet die Code School verschiedene Wege, die Sie befolgen können, um bestimmte Fähigkeiten zu erstellen. Wenn Sie bereit sind, einfach direkt einzutauchen, können Sie auch Kurse aus der gesamten Bibliothek auswählen und die meisten Kurse der Grundstufe sind 100% kostenlos. |
| 42 | Code Avengers | Wenn Sie lernen möchten, wie Sie eine Website, Apps oder Spiele erstellen, ist Code Avengers die Website für Sie. Code Avengers hat über 100 Stunden Kurse, wie Sie mit dem Bau von Websites in HTML & CSS und Spielen oder Apps in JavaScript gelernt werden. |
| 43 | Projekt Euler | Project Euler ist eine Website, die sich einer Reihe von Computerproblemen widmet, die mit Computerprogrammen gelöst werden sollen. Das Projekt zieht Absolventen und Studenten an, die sich für Mathematik und Computerprogramme interessieren. |
| 44 | Django Girls | Django Girls ist eine internationale gemeinnützige Organisation, die gegründet wurde, um Frauen aus allen Bereichen dazu zu inspirieren, sich für Technologie zu interessieren und Programmierer zu werden und ein sicheres und freundliches Umfeld zu bieten. |
| 45 | Mothercoder | Mothercoder ist eine gemeinnützige Organisation, deren Mission es ist, Frauen mit Kindern auf dem Rand zu helfen, Karrieren in der Technik zu erzielen, damit sie in einer digitalen Wirtschaft gedeihen können. |
| 46 | Mädchen, die codieren | Mädchen, die codieren, ist eine gemeinnützige Organisation, die die Anzahl der Frauen in Informatik unterstützen und erhöhen will, indem junge Frauen die notwendigen Rechenfähigkeiten ausstatten, um Chancen des 21. Jahrhunderts zu verfolgen. |
| 47 | Pyadies | Pyladies ist eine internationale Mentorship-Gruppe, die sich darauf konzentriert, mehr Frauen aktiv an der Python Open-Source-Community teilzunehmen. |
| 48 | Railsgirls | Sie wollen Tools und eine Gemeinschaft für Frauen geben, um Technologie zu verstehen und ihre Ideen aufzubauen |
| 49 | Codenewbie | Eine der unterstützendsten Community von Programmierern. |
| 50 | MIT App Erfinder | MIT App Inventor ist eine visuelle Programmierumgebung, in der alle Altersgruppen von Lernenden voll funktionsfähige Apps für Android- und iOS -Smartphones und Tablets erstellen können. |
| 51 | codegrepper.com | Es ist das ultimative Abfrage- und Antwortsystem für Programmierer. |
| 52 | visualgo.net/en | Visualisierung von Datenstrukturen und Algorithmen durch Animation. |
| Ausweis | Kanalname | Beschreibung |
|---|---|---|
| 1 | Freecodecamp | Ihre Videos sind langfristige Inhalte über verschiedene Programmiersprachen mit Wiedergabelisten für Anfänger und Experten. Ihre Videos von drei Stunden und wenigen Minuten umfassen traditionelle und moderne Technologien wie HTML, JavaScript, PHP, CSS, ML, Data Science und Python. Der YouTube -Kanal ist bei über 5 Millionen Studenten und mehreren Wiedergabelisten sehr beliebt. |
| 2 | Programmierung mit Mosh | Mosh Hamedani ist bestrebt, Codierer und Software -Ingenieure so auszubilden, dass Talentunternehmen einstellen möchten. |
| 3 | Traversy-Media | Der von Brad Travery erstellte Kanal deckt Programmtechnologien wie HTML, CSS und JavaScript, Frontend -Frameworks wie React und Vue sowie Backend -Konzepte wie Node.js, Python und PHP ab. |
| 4 | fireship.io | Sind Sie erschöpft, wenn Sie 6 -Stunden -Tutorial -Videos auf YouTube ansehen? Dann ist dieser Kanal für Sie. Er erklärt die komplexesten Programmierkonzepte in 5 Minuten. |
| 5 | Kevin-Powell | Hasst du CSS? Dann wird dich dieser Typ auf jeden Fall dazu bringen, sich in CSS zu verlieben! |
| 6 | Web-dev-simplifiziert | Wie der Name schon sagt, zielt dieser Kanal darauf ab, die Webentwicklung zu vereinfachen. |
| 7 | Dev-Ed | Möchten Sie coole JavaScript -Animationen lernen? Dann schauen Sie sich den richtigen Ort an! |
| 8 | The Net-Ninja | Das Net Ninja ist einer der besten YouTube -Kanäle, um mehr über Webentwicklung und Programmierung zu erfahren. |
| 9 | Baumhaus | Team Treehouse ist eine Online -Lernplattform, die für Anfänger, die begeistert sind, eine Karriere im Codieren aufzubauen. |
| 10 | Dev-Tipps | DevTips ist eine wöchentliche Show für Webdesigner und Codierer mit über 200 Videos auf CSS, HTML, Docker, Kubernetes, Github und mehr. |
| 11 | Designcourse.com | Für einen Entwickler ist es wichtig, grundlegende Kenntnisse über Designkonzepte zu haben. Dieser Kanal hilft Ihnen, Ihre Designfähigkeiten zu verbessern. |
| 12 | Code-with-Ania-Kubow | Liebst du Spiele? Ihre Videos helfen Ihnen, mehr Spiele zu entwickeln, indem Sie Schritt -für -Schritt -Tutorials (JavaScript) folgen |
| 13 | Damalswaston | Ihre Videos behandeln eine Reihe von Themen von Modern Blockchain, Docker und Discord bis SEO, Python, Node.js und Gulp.Js. Bucky Roberts ist ein IT -Absolvent und unterrichtet leicht zu verstehen, was den Kanal zu einer perfekten Ressource für Anfängerprogrammierer macht. |
| 14 | Online-Tutorials | Dieser Kanal hilft Ihnen, tief in fantastische CSS -Animationen einzutauchen. |
| 15 | Florin-Pop | Er wird Ihnen viel über die Webentwicklung beibringen (HTML, CSS, JavaScript, Reactjs, NodeJs, APIs und alle anderen coolen Sachen?) |
| 16 | Programmwitherik | Wenn Sie Codierungs -Tutorials und -Rates wünschen, besuchen Sie diesen Kanal |
| 17 | CSDOJO | Er hilft Ihrem Crack DSA (Datenstruktur und Algorithmus) Probleme und Fragen und stellt die Codierungsinterviews aus. |
| 18 | CleverProgrammer | Möchten Sie reale Projekte aufbauen und mehr Tiefe in Ihren Fähigkeiten verdienen? Klicken Sie dann jetzt auf den Link! |
| 19 | JavaScriptMastery | Starten Sie Ihre Entwicklungskarriere mit projektbasiertem Coaching - Präsentieren |
| 20 | CodedAmn | Hilft Ihnen, Ihre Programmierfähigkeiten zu verbessern |
| 21 | Codewithharry | Es gibt viele Codierungs -Tutorials und Entwicklungsberatung gibt es. |
| 22 | Jenseits von Feuerwehrleitungen | Der Sekundärkanal von FireShip.io mit ausführlicherem Inhalt. |
| Ausweis | Blogs | Beschreibung |
|---|---|---|
| 1 | Dev.to | Dev Community ist eine Gemeinschaft von 938.136 erstaunlichen Entwicklern. Wir sind ein Ort, an dem Codierer teilen, auf dem Laufenden bleiben und ihre Karriere ausbauen. |
| 2 | CSS-Tricks | Tägliche Artikel über CSS, HTML, JavaScript und alle Dinge, die sich auf Webdesign und -entwicklung beziehen. |
| 3 | Medium | |
| 4 | Freecodecamp | |
| 5 | Stackoverflow.blog | |
| 6 | Realpython | |
| 7 | Codinghorror | |
| 8 | Webdesignerdepot | |
| 9 | Hackernoon | |
| 10 | Sololearn | Sololearn ist eine Plattform, auf der wir Programmiersprachen auf modulische Weise üben können, und es öffnet die Community, um Ach -andere zu interagieren, um Wissen zu erlangen und auszutauschen. Außerdem wird die Blogs nach ein paar Bewertungen konsistent zur Verfügung gestellt. |
| 11 | W3schools | W3schools ist für das Lernen, Testen und Training optimiert. Beispiele können vereinfacht werden, um das Lesen und das grundlegende Verständnis zu verbessern. Tutorials, Referenzen. |
| 12 | Addy Osmanis Blog | Addy ist technischer Manager bei Google und schreibt über verschiedene Themen in der Webentwicklung. |
Wenn Sie das Repo genossen haben, zögern Sie nicht, ihm einen Stern zu geben? Teilen Sie es Ihren Freunden und zusammen können wir die Community besser wachsen lassen ☕